The Orvane Labs bike cage and the east and west parking gates operate on separate access schedules, and facilities desk staff should note that visitor vehicles may only use the west gate between 07:00 and 19:00. Cyclists requesting cage access must show a valid day pass, and their details should be entered in the access ledger before the cage is opened. Gates must never be propped open, even briefly, during deliveries. When a manual override is required at either gate, use the code below.

staff pass of fadup-fawig = bdg-FUNKS-4

Action item from the Verdalia greenhouse incident review: the humidity sensors in Bay 3 drifted roughly 4% per week, and the controller compensated by overwatering. Since you're new to the Cloverbed codebase, note that recalibration runs nightly, and the drift correction coefficients live in firmware config rather than the cloud layer. The constants we settled on after two weeks of testing are as follows.

tuning table, kajog-kawef:
PRIORITIES = {
    "kelox": 870,
    "kasix": 89,
    "eliax": 988,
}

CI troubleshooting note — Fennwick pipeline, stale-cache postmortem. Last quarter, builds intermittently shipped outdated assets because the cache key omitted the compiler flags, so flag changes silently reused old artifacts. The fix hashes the full toolchain configuration into the key, and a nightly job now evicts entries older than seven days. If you ever see mismatched assets again, first compare the cache key in the build log against the expected hash. Cross-check both against the trace token recorded just below.

build token for kagaf-hahof: htk14_9d3d4d26d7d8de

## Onboarding: Fareweight Rules Engine

Fareweight computes shipping fees from stacked rule sets. Rules are versioned; never edit a live version. Deploys go through the staging evaluator first. Read the rule DSL guide before touching anything.

Rule definitions live in the pricing database — connect to it with the connection string below.

primary connection of yagep-bajop = postgresql://druiel_svc:gW@db-3860.sivrelworks.example:5432/brieth